body {
	background:        url(http://www.surebetbookies.com/images/bg.png);
	background-repeat: repeat-x;
	background-color:  #333333;
	margin:            0px;
	padding:           0px;
	font-family:       "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size:         15px;
    }


p {
    margin:  0px;
    padding: 0px;
 }
#list { text-align: left; margin: 0; padding: 0 15px 0 30px; }
a {
    font-size:       15px;
    color:           #1c2aaf;
    text-decoration: underline;
 }



form {

	padding-left: 18px;


     }



table {
	 border: 0px;

	 margin: 0px;
    }


fieldset {

	    border:  0px;

	    margin:  0px;

	    padding: 0px;

	    width:   310px;
 }


td {



vertical-align:top;



}



a.ownline {



	     padding:         0px 35px;



	     font-size:       15px;



	     color:           #1c2aaf;



	     text-decoration: underline;



	  }







a.rsd {font-size: 13px; color: #880000; text-decoration: underline; }



a.search { color: #000; font-size: 14px; font-style: normal; font-weight: normal; text-decoration: none; }
.searchr { color: #000; font-size: 12px; font-style: normal; font-weight: normal; text-decoration: none; text-align: right; }
a:hover.search { color: #000; font-size: 14px; font-style: normal; font-weight: normal; text-decoration: underline; }

a.menu { font-size:       13px; color:           #1c2aaf; text-decoration: underline; padding:         0px 22px; font-size:       13px; }
a.divlink, a.divlink:link { display:block; width:100%; height:100%; line-height:0; font-size:0; }

a.resulttextheadingbig { padding:     0px 2px; font-size:   18px; color:       #1c2aaf; font-weight: bold;  text-decoration: none; }

div.container { background: url(http://www.surebetbookies.com/images/container-bg.jpg); background-repeat: repeat; width:      1000px; height:     auto;  position:   relative; }
div.filters { position: relative; width: 300px; height: auto; float: left; }
div.exclusions { position: relative; width: 300px; height: auto; float: right; }
div.containertop { background: url(http://www.surebetbookies.com/images/container-top.jpg); width:      1000px; height:     182px; }

div.menu { position:   absolute; width:      1000px; left:       0px; top:        0px;  z-index:    2; }

div.containerbottom {  background: url(http://www.surebetbookies.com/images/container-bottom.jpg); width:      1000px; height:     31px; }

div.newsheader { position: absolute; left:     27px; top:      150px; }

div.newsbody {	width:         175px;	position:      absolute;	left:          27px;	top:           167px;	padding-top:   13px;   }

p.newstext { padding: 0 22px; font-size: 11px; text-decoration: none; }
a.newstext { font-size: 11px; text-decoration: none; }
p.newstextheading {



		     padding:     0px 22px;



		     font-size:   13px;



		     color:       #1c2aaf;



		     font-weight: bold;



		  }







p.bodytext {



	      padding:     0px 18px;



	      text-indent: 13px;



	   }







p.resulttext {



	        padding: 0px 2px;



		font-size:   12px;



		text-align: left;



		color: #000000;



	     }
p.si { color: #000000; font-size: 12px; text-align: left; padding: 0 15px 0 20px; }
a.resulttext { color: #000000; font-size: 12px; text-align: left; padding: 0 2px; }
a.details { color: #000000; font-size: 12px; text-decoration: none; text-align: left; padding: 0 2px; vertical-align: super; }
font.resulttext { font-size:   12px; color: #1c2aaf; text-decoration: none; }
p.resulttextheading { padding:     0px 2px; font-size:   13px; color:       #1c2aaf;  font-weight: bold; }
p.alertheading { color: #1c2aaf; font-size: 12px; font-weight: bold; padding: 0px; }\
a.alertheading { color: #1c2aaf; font-size: 12px; font-weight: bold; text-decoration: none; padding: 0px; }
a.resulttextheading { color: #1c2aaf; font-size: 13px; font-weight: bold; text-decoration: none; padding: 0 2px; }
a:hover.resulttextheading { color: #666daf; font-size: 13px; font-weight: bold; text-decoration: none; padding: 0 2px; }
p.resulttextheadingbig { padding:     0px 2px; font-size:   18px;  color:       #1c2aaf; font-weight: bold; }
p.bodytextheading { padding:     12px 9px 12px 18px; color:       #1c2aaf; font-weight: bold; font-size:   18px; }
p.bodytextheadingr {  padding:     12px 18px 12px 9px; color:       #1c2aaf; font-weight: bold;  font-size:   18px; }
p.footertext {  font-size: 13px; }
div.bodyheader { position: relative;  left:     89px;  top:      -30px; width:    754px; }







div.bodybody {



		width:         754px;



	        position:      relative;



	        left:          89px;



		padding-top:   8px;



		top:           -30px;
		text-align:center;



	     }

.tutor {
width:5px;
visibility:hidden;
}

.resultscolhead {

		border-right: solid 1px #dfdfdf;

		border-bottom: solid 1px #dfdfdf;

		vertical-align:top;
		
		text-align:left;

		}

.resultscolheadlast {

		border-bottom: solid 1px #dfdfdf;

		vertical-align:top;
		
		text-align:left;

		}

.resultscolcon {

		border-right: solid 1px #dfdfdf;

		border-bottom: dashed 1px #dfdfdf;

		vertical-align:top;
		
		text-align:left;

		}

.resultscolconlast {

		border-bottom: dashed 1px #dfdfdf;

		vertical-align:top;
		
		text-align:left;

		}

p.exp { color: #000000; font-size: 10px; text-align: justify; padding: 0 2px 5px; }

p.expr { color: #000000; font-size: 10px; font-weight: bold; text-align: right; padding: 0 2px 5px; }

a.exp { color: #666daf; font-size: 10px; text-decoration: none; text-align: justify; padding: 0 2px 5px; }

a.expr { color: #666daf; font-size: 10px; font-weight: bold; text-decoration: none; text-align: right; padding: 0 2px 5px; }

h1.exp { color: #1c2aaf; font-size: 14px; font-weight: bold; padding: 0 2px; }

div.formheader {
		  margin:auto;
		  padding:10px;
		  font-size:15px;
		  color:#1c2aaf;
		  font-weight:bold;
		  text-align:left;
	       }

div.formright {
		  margin:0px;
		  padding:2px 2px 2px 5px;
		  text-align:left;
		  width:600px;
		  float:left;
	      }

div.formleft {
		 margin:0px;
		 padding:2px 5px 2px 2px;
		 text-align:right;
		 width:120px;
		 float:left;
	     }

div.formcenter {
		 padding:2px 2px 2px 10px;
		 text-align:left;
		 width:750px;
	       }

form { padding:0px;	margin:0px; }
input.sb1 { width : 10px; height : 10px; overflow : hidden; padding : 12px 0 0 0; background : url('/images/up.gif') no-repeat; border : 0;}
input.sb2 { width : 10px; height : 10px; overflow : hidden; padding : 12px 0 0 0; background : url('/images/down.gif') no-repeat; border : 0;}

p.aaa { text-align: justify; margin: 0; padding: 0 15px 13px; }
a.aaa { color: #000; font-weight: normal; text-decoration: none; text-align: justify; margin: 0; padding-top: 0; }
a:hover.aaa { color: #1c2aaf; font-weight: normal; text-decoration: none; text-align: justify; margin: 0; padding-top: 0; }
h1 { color: #1c2aaf; font-size: 20pt; font-weight: bold; text-decoration: underline; text-align: justify; text-indent: 0; padding-right: 18px; padding-left: 18px; }
h2 { color: #666daf; font-size: 16pt; font-weight: bold; font-style: italic; line-height: 18pt; text-align: justify; text-indent: 13px; vertical-align: text-bottom; padding-right: 18px; padding-left: 18px; }
h3 { color: #1c2aaf; font-size: 14px; font-weight: bold; line-height: 2px; text-decoration: underline; text-align: justify; text-indent: 16px; padding-right: 18px; padding-left: 18px; }
.h1 { color:           #1c2aaf; font-size:       20pt; font-weight:     bold; text-decoration: underline; text-align: justify; position:        relative; }

.h2 { color:       #666daf; font-size:   16pt; font-style:  italic; font-weight: bold; text-align: justify; position:    relative; }

.h3 { color:           #1c2aaf; font-weight:     bold; text-decoration: underline; text-align: justify; position:        relative; }
td.smalltext { font-size: 14px; margin: 0; padding: 0; }

.more {
    display: none;



